高效液相色谱法分析生漆多糖中的单糖组成   总被引:5,自引:0,他引:5  
杜予民  王晓燕  柳卫莉  蒙缔亚 《色谱》1998,16(2):173-175
采用μ-BondapakNH2TM色谱柱,以乙腈∶水∶甲醇(70∶25∶5,V/V)为流动相,利用示差折光检测器的高效液相色谱法对湖北毛坝大木、毛坝小木和建始3种生漆中漆多糖的单糖组成成分进行了直接分离分析,方法简便、快速、重现性好,回收率在98.8%~103.6%之间,相对标准偏差在5%以下。  相似文献

BIODEGRADATION OF REGENERATED CELLULOSE FILMS BY FUNGI   总被引:1,自引:0,他引:1  
The biodegradability of Aspergillus niger (A. niger), Mucor (M-305) and Trichoderma(T-311) strains on regenerated cellulose films in media was investigated. The results showedthat T-311 strain isolated from soil adhered on the cellulose film fragments has strongerdegradation effect on the cellulose film than A. niger strain. The weights, molecular weightsand tensile strengths of the cellulose films in both shake culture and solid media decreasedwith incubation time, accompanied by producing CO_2 and saccharides. HPLC, IR and re-leased CO_2 analysis indicated that the biodegradation products of the regenerated cellulosefilms mainly contain oligosaccharides, cellobiose, glucose, arabinose, erythrose, glycerose,glycerol, ethanal, formaldehyde and organic acid, the end products were CO_2 and water.After a month, the films were completely decomposed by fungi in the media at 30℃.  相似文献
